Our Read. Uranium Royalty looks cheap on the screen and we do not trust the screen. At $4.47 the stock trades at 10.0x trailing earnings, below its own two-year median of 24.3x and below the peer median of 11.7x [1]. Our open hypothesis on this name, sealed today with low belief, says the earnings the market can see came from selling inventory that no longer exists [2]. Cheap on a multiple built from one-time sales is not cheap.
Positioning status. Watch. Not positioned; our book holds no UROY [3]. Looking for an entry at $4.19 with evidence the revenue repeats.
The stock. The price has run: up 60.2% over 60 trading days, now 18.1% below the January closing high of $5.46 [1]. Eight in ten closes since mid-March sat between $2.78 and $4.19, so today's $4.47 is above where this stock has normally traded this year [1]. When it falls, it falls hard: 52.2% from January to July, not recovered [1]. $4.19, the top of that band, is where we would rather own it.
The business. Trailing revenue is $397.3 million with a 24.1% profit margin, and the quarter to April 2026 grew revenue 1,123.4% year on year [1]. Growth of that size in a royalty and physical-holdings company is the tell that supports our read: this looks like inventory being sold, not a run rate. We have no filing on hand for this name and the ledger carries no prior management entries, so the repeatability question stays open until the next reported period.
The tape. Thursday traded 965,101 shares against a 2.16 million 20-day average, 44.78% of normal [4]. No insider Form 4 filings in the last 180 days, and short interest at the 2026-08-14 settlement was 4.02 million shares, 3.21% of the float, 1.39 days to cover [4]. Quiet, in both directions.
